Understanding This Legal Service

Buy-sell agreements outline how ownership changes occur when an owner exits, dies, or becomes disabled.

Key elements include valuation methods, funding arrangements, triggering events, and dispute resolution procedures.

Definition and Explanation

A buy-sell agreement is a contract among business owners that sets terms for when and how shares or interests are bought and sold.

Key Elements and Processes

Typical components include ownership structure, valuation method, funding strategy, purchase price adjustments, and administrative steps to implement changes.

Key Terms and Glossary

Glossary entries define common terms used in buy-sell provisions for clarity.

Buy-Sell Agreement

A contract that governs how ownership interests are transferred when certain events occur.

Valuation

The method used to determine the fair price of a stake in the business.

Funding

The means by which the purchase price is paid, such as cash, notes, or a combination.

Trigger Event

Events that activate the buy-sell process, like owner death, disability, or departure.

What is a buy-sell agreement and why do I need one in California?

Buy-sell agreements provide a clear process for ownership changes and can prevent disputes. Many businesses tailor these provisions to fit their goals.

Valuation methods may include fixed price, formula, or independent appraisal, chosen to reflect the business.

Funding options include cash, seller notes, or third-party financing, depending on the agreement.

Regular reviews help ensure the plan remains aligned with growth, tax rules, and financing needs.

Yes, you can tailor buy-sell provisions to corporations, LLCs, or partnerships to fit ownership structures.

If a triggering event occurs before funding, alternatives and timelines are defined in the agreement.

Buy-sell agreements can impact taxes and financing strategies and should be coordinated with tax planning.

Drafting time depends on complexity, but a thorough draft typically takes weeks, with review time.

Yes, many provisions can be updated as the business changes, with proper amendment processes.
